The Verdict

These are fundamentally different devices masquerading under the same category. The Acer Swift X 14 is a traditional ultrabook laptop designed for productivity and content creation, while the ASUS ROG Ally is a handheld gaming device. Comparing them directly is like evaluating a sedan against a motorcycle. The Swift X excels with its 14.5-inch 2.8K OLED display (2880 x 1800, 90Hz), Intel Core Ultra 7 155H processor, 16GB LPDDR5x RAM, and 12-hour battery life, making it suitable for professional work and everyday computing. Its aluminum chassis, proper keyboard, dual USB-A ports, and Thunderbolt support provide genuine productivity versatility. The ROG Ally's 7-inch IPS LCD (1920 x 1080, 120Hz), AMD Ryzen Z1 Extreme, and 40Wh battery deliver respectable handheld gaming performance but severely limit it for laptop tasks. Battery life of 1.5-7 hours depending on game load is impractical for work. At $999, the Swift X offers better long-term value for anyone needing an actual laptop. The ROG Ally at $699 makes sense only if you specifically want a portable gaming device and accept Windows 11 handheld compromises. Choose the Swift X for work or general computing; choose the Ally only for gaming-focused portability.

Pros & Cons

Acer Swift X 14 (2024)

Pros

  • 2.8K OLED display at $999 is exceptional value
  • Discrete RTX 3050 GPU option for light creative work
  • Good port selection including SD card and USB-A
  • Solid build quality from aluminum chassis
  • Upgradeable SSD

Cons

  • Only one Thunderbolt port
  • Fan noise becomes noticeable under sustained load
  • Battery life trails fanless ultrabooks
  • 90Hz OLED refresh rate behind 120Hz peers
  • RAM is soldered — no upgrade path

ASUS ROG Ally

Pros

  • Ryzen Z1 Extreme with RDNA 3 GPU outperforms Steam Deck in raw power
  • Full 1080p IPS display at 120Hz for sharper and smoother gaming
  • Windows 11 gives access to all PC game stores and launchers
  • Lighter at 608 g compared to the Steam Deck
  • MicroSD expansion for extra game storage

Cons

  • 40 Wh battery provides very poor endurance — as low as 1.5 hours
  • Windows 11 is not optimized for handheld — requires workarounds
  • Only one USB-C port limits simultaneous charging and peripherals
  • No OLED — IPS LCD has weaker contrast and no true blacks
  • Fan noise is loud under heavy gaming loads
